However, since we have no perfect square factors, this is about as simplified as we can get. 10 = 2 * 5 since no factor is repeated, the square root cannot be simplified. Since 10 = 2 ⋅ 5, we can rewrite this as. Web sqrt(10) is already in simplest form. Sqrt(35/9) = sqrt(35)/sqrt(9) in other words, the square root of the entire fraction is the same as the square root of the numerator divided by the square root of the denominator.
